Mining is dominated by large companies, most of them publicly listed. The sector is typically made up of multi-national companies sustained by mineral production from their mining operations. It takes place in many countries throughout the world, and as of 2007 the total market capitalisation of mining companies was reported at US$962 billion.
In addition to these two sectors, various other industries such as equipment manufacture, environmental testing and metallurgy analysis also rely on and support the mining industry throughout the world. Canadian stock exchanges have a particular focus on mining companies.
